The accessibility settings will determine the size of the text and
characters, time outs, call alerts, and volumes on the phone.
1
From the Home screen, press the left soft key
<
[Start]
.
2
Select
Settings
and press
OK
.
3
Select ‘
More..
.’, press
OK
, and then select
Accessibility
.
4
Using the left and right Navigation Keys, select
your preferences for the following:
• System font size: set the size of the font that is displayed
on the screen.
• Multi-press time out: set the length of time between key
presses when entering text in Multi-tap mode.
• Confirmation time out: set the delay before an unconfirmed
action times out.
• In-call alert volume: set the volume of sounds that play
during a call.
5
Press
[Done]
.
